On 11/13/2014 05:15 AM, Alexandre DERUMIER wrote:
Hi,

I have redone perf with dwarf

perf record -g --call-graph dwarf -a -F 99  -- sleep 60

I have put perf reports, ceph conf, fio config here:

http://odisoweb1.odiso.net/cephperf/

test setup
-----------
client cpu config :  8 x Intel(R) Xeon(R) CPU E5-2603 v2 @ 1.80GHz
ceph cluster : 3 nodes (same cpu than client) with 2 osd each (intel ssd s3500), test pool with replication x1
rbd volume size : 10G (almost all reads are done in osd buffer cache)

benchmark with fio 4k randread, with 1 rbd volume. (also tested with 20 rbd volumes, results are equals).
debian wheezy - kernel 3.17 - and ceph packages from master on gitbuilder

(BTW, I have installed librbd/rados dbg packages but I have missing symbols ?)

I think if you run perf report with verbose enabled it will tell you which symbols are missing:

perf report -v 2>&1 | less

If you have them but it's not detecting them properly you can clean out the cache or even manually reassign the symbols but it's annoying.




Global results:
---------------
librbd : 60000iops : 98% cpu
krbd : 90000iops : 32% cpu


So, librbd usage is 4,5x more than krbd for same ios throughput

The difference seem to be quite huge, is it expected ?

librbd perf report:
-------------------------
top cpu usage
--------------
25.71%              fio  libc-2.13.so
17.69%              fio  librados.so.2.0.0
12.38%              fio  librbd.so.1.0.0
27.99%              fio  [kernel.kallsyms]
4.19%               fio  libpthread-2.13.so


libc-2.13.so (seem that malloc/free use a lot of cpu here)
------------
     21.05%-- _int_malloc
     14.36%-- free
     13.66%-- malloc
     9.89%-- __lll_unlock_wake_private
     5.35%-- __clone
     4.38%-- __poll
     3.77%-- __memcpy_ssse3
     1.64%-- vfprintf
     1.02%-- arena_get2


I think we need to figure out why so much time is being spent mallocing/freeing memory. Got to get those symbols resolved!
